What Is Bladeless LASIK and Just How Does It Work?
Bladeless LASIK is a contemporary vision adjustment treatment that utilizes innovative innovation to reshape the cornea without the requirement for a medical blade. Instead of a blade, it employs a laser to create a slim flap in the cornea, allowing the surgeon to access the underlying cells.
When the flap is lifted, one more laser precisely eliminates microscopic quantities of corneal cells, correcting your vision. This approach improves accuracy and decreases discomfort throughout the treatment.
You'll experience a quicker recovery time and less threat of issues contrasted to conventional LASIK. If you're considering vision improvement, comprehending exactly how Bladeless LASIK jobs can help you make an informed choice about whether it's the right choice for you.

Who Is a Good Prospect for Bladeless LASIK?
Are you wondering if you receive Bladeless LASIK? Good prospects commonly consist of adults over 18 with stable vision and no significant eye problems, like cataracts or extreme dry eyes.
You must additionally have a prescription that hasn't altered much in the past year. If you're usually healthy and balanced and not pregnant or nursing, you're likely an ideal prospect.
Those with thin corneas may still qualify, thanks to the innovative innovation utilized in Bladeless LASIK. Your ophthalmologist will examine your particular requirements and problems throughout a thorough examination.
What Should I Anticipate During the Bladeless LASIK Treatment?
As you get ready for your Bladeless LASIK procedure, you can anticipate a structured process that prioritizes your convenience and safety and security.
When you arrive, the staff will certainly lead you through the required pre-operative actions, guaranteeing you feel comfortable. You'll get numbing eye decreases, so you won't feel any type of discomfort throughout the treatment.
As soon as you're cleared up, the medical professional will certainly utilize a laser to develop a slim flap in your cornea without any blades. You'll be asked to focus on a light, and the laser will certainly reshape your cornea to boost your vision.
The whole procedure normally takes about 15 mins per eye. Afterward, you'll rest briefly before heading home, where you can start your trip to clearer vision.
What Are the Possible Risks and Complications?
While Bladeless LASIK is usually secure and efficient, it's important to be aware of possible risks and complications that can emerge.
Some people experience completely dry eyes, which can be short-lived or, in rare instances, durable. You might additionally observe glare, halos, or double vision, especially in the evening.
Infections, while uncommon, can take place and may require extra therapy. There's additionally a chance that your vision mightn't totally correct, causing the demand for glasses or get in touch with lenses post-surgery.
In really uncommon instances, more major complications like corneal flap issues can develop.
Always discuss these prospective risks with your doctor, as they can supply tailored insights based upon your specific scenario and aid you make a notified choice.

What Are the Expenses Entailed With Bladeless LASIK?
Wondering what you'll require to allocate Bladeless LASIK? The prices can differ, normally varying from $2,000 to $3,500 per eye. Variables like your surgeon's experience, modern technology utilized, and your particular vision needs influence the rate.
Many centers provide funding alternatives, enabling you to manage settlements with time. Furthermore, don't forget pre-operative examinations and post-operative follow-ups, which might add to your total price.
Some insurance policy intends partially cover the treatment, so consult your carrier to understand your insurance coverage.
